react useState update not triggering with custom hook - reactjs

I made a custom hook for my player like this
const usePlayer = () => {
const [volume, setVolume] = useState<number>(100);
const playerRef = useRef<HTMLAudioElement | null>(null);
const [playing, setPlaying] = useState<boolean>(false);
useEffect(() => {
console.log(volume);
}, [volume]);
return {
playing,
volume,
setPlaying,
setVolume,
playerRef,
};
};
export default usePlayer;
I am listening for changes in another component which uses the userPlayer()
const PlayerButton = () => {
const { playerRef, volume } = usePlayer();
useEffect(() => {
console.log(volume);
if (playerRef.current !== null) {
playerRef.current.volume = volume / 100;
}
}, [volume]);
return (
<>
<div className="lg:mr-2 flex align-middle">
<audio ref={playerRef} preload="none">
<source src="" type="audio/ogg"></source>
<source src="" type="audio/mp3"></source>
</audio>
</div>
</>
);
};
export default PlayerButton
the setVolume is called like this in another component
<input
type="range"
className="w-full"
value={volume}
onChange={(e) => setVolume(parseInt(e.target.value))}
min={0}
max={100}
/>
But the useEffect does only trigger inside the usePlayer component and not in the second component who uses the usePlayer()
any idea why ?

If you use setVolume in PlayerButton component, it will trigger the useEffect in PlayerButton.
It will not trigger the useEffect if you are using setVolume in a different component.
Do two components using the same Hook share state? No. Custom Hooks
are a mechanism to reuse stateful logic (such as setting up a
subscription and remembering the current value), but every time you
use a custom Hook, all state and effects inside of it are fully
isolated.
How does a custom Hook get isolated state? Each call to a Hook gets
isolated state. Because we call useFriendStatus directly, from React’s
point of view our component just calls useState and useEffect. And as
we learned earlier, we can call useState and useEffect many times in
one component, and they will be completely independent.
https://reactjs.org/docs/hooks-custom.html
If you want 2 components to share state, you need to use redux or useContext to manage the state in a store.
https://reactjs.org/docs/hooks-reference.html#usecontext
Example use of useContext and Provider.
export const PlayerContext = createContext();
export const usePlayer = () => {
const context = useContext(PlayerContext);
if (!context && typeof window !== 'undefined') {
throw new Error(`usePlayer must be used within a PlayerContext `);
}
return context;
};
export const PlayerProvider = ({ children }) => {
const [ volume, setVolume ] = useState(100);
return <PlayerContext.Provider value={{ volume, setVolume }}>{children}</PlayerContext.Provider>
}
You need to wrap your app with the provider like this.
<PlayerProvider><App /></PlayerProvider>
Then use it like this
const { volume, setVolume } = usePlayer()

React Context is not working as expected: Unable to change the value of shared variable

I made a context to share the value of the variable "clicked" throughout my nextjs pages, it seems to give no errors but as you can see the variable's value remains FALSE even after the click event. It does not change to TRUE. This is my first time working with context, what am I doing wrong?
I'm using typescript
PS: After the onClick event the log's number shoots up by 3 or 4, is it being executed more than once, but how?
controlsContext.tsx
import { createContext, FC, useState } from "react";
export interface MyContext {
clicked: boolean;
changeClicked?: () => void;
}
const defaultState = {
clicked: false,
}
const ControlContext = createContext<MyContext>(defaultState);
export const ControlProvider: FC = ({ children }) => {
const [clicked, setClicked] = useState(defaultState.clicked);
const changeClicked = () => setClicked(!clicked);
return (
<ControlContext.Provider
value={{
clicked,
changeClicked,
}}
>
{children}
</ControlContext.Provider>
);
};
export default ControlContext;
Model.tsx
import ControlContext from "../contexts/controlsContext";
export default function Model (props:any) {
const group = useRef<THREE.Mesh>(null!)
const {clicked, changeClicked } = useContext(ControlContext);
const handleClick = (e: MouseEvent) => {
//e.preventDefault();
changeClicked();
console.log(clicked);
}
useEffect(() => {
console.log(clicked);
}, [clicked]);
useFrame((state, delta) => (group.current.rotation.y += 0.01));
const model = useGLTF("/scene.gltf ");
return (
<>
<TransformControls enabled={clicked}>
<mesh
ref={group}
{...props}
scale={clicked ? 0.5 : 0.2}
onClick={handleClick}
>
<primitive object={model.scene}/>
</mesh>
</TransformControls>
</>
)
}
_app.tsx
import {ControlProvider} from '../contexts/controlsContext';
function MyApp({ Component, pageProps }: AppProps) {
return (
<ControlProvider>
<Component {...pageProps}
/>
</ControlProvider>
)
}
export default MyApp
Issues
You are not actually invoking the changeClicked callback.
React state updates are asynchronously processed, so you can't log the state being updated in the same callback scope as the enqueued update, it will only ever log the state value from the current render cycle, not what it will be in a subsequent render cycle.
You've listed the changeClicked callback as optional, so Typescript will warn you if you don't use a null-check before calling changeClicked.
Solution
const { clicked, changeClicked } = useContext(ControlContext);
...
<mesh
...
onClick={(event) => {
changeClicked && changeClicked();
}}
>
...
</mesh>
...
Or declare the changeClicked as required in call normally. You are already providing changeClicked as part of the default context value, and you don't conditionally include in in the provider, so there's no need for it to be optional.
export interface MyContext {
clicked: boolean,
changeClicked: () => void
}
...
const { clicked, changeClicked } = useContext(ControlContext);
...
<mesh
...
onClick={(event) => {
changeClicked();
}}
>
...
</mesh>
...
Use an useEffect hook in to log any state updates.
const { clicked, changeClicked } = useContext(ControlContext);
useEffect(() => {
console.log(clicked);
}, [clicked]);
Update
After working with you and your sandbox it needed a few tweaks.
Wrapping the index.tsx JSX code with the ControlProvider provider component so there was a valid context value being provided to the app. The UI here had to be refactored into a React component so it could itself also consume the context value.
It seems there was some issue with the HTML canvas element, or the mesh element that was preventing the Modal component from maintaining a "solid" connection with the React context. It wasn't overtly clear what the issue was here, but passing the context values directly to the Modal component as props resolved the issue with the changeClicked callback becoming undefined.
A few things -
setClicked((prev) => !prev);
instead of
setClicked(!clicked);
As it ensures it's not using stale state. Then you are also doing -
changeClicked
But it should be -
changeClicked();
Lastly, you cannot console.log(clicked) straight after calling the set state function, it will be updated in the next render

useState not updating[NOT AN ASYNC ISSUE]

I'm new to react hooks so I'm practicing with showing and hiding a div when checking and unckecking a checkbox input. The problem is that the state updates on the main file where I have the function that handles it but in the file where I actually have the div it does not update so it does not hide or display.
File that handles the change of the state:
import {react, useState} from "react";
export const Checker = () => {
const [checked, setChecked] = useState(true)
const clickHandler = () => {
setChecked(!checked)
console.log(checked)
}
return {checked, clickHandler, setChecked}
}
File where the checkbox is located:
import React from "react";
import { Extras, Wrapper } from "./extras.styles";
import { Checker } from "../hooks/useCheckboxes";
const Extra = () => {
const {checked, setChecked, clickHandler} = Checker()
return <>
<Extras>
<Wrapper>
<input type= 'checkbox' onClick={clickHandler} checked = {checked} onChange={e => setChecked(e.target.checked)}></input>
</Wrapper>
</Extras>
</>
}
export default Extra;
File that contains the div i want to display and hide dynamically:
import house from '../../icons/house.png'
import { Wrapper } from "./foto.styles";
import { Checker } from "../hooks/useCheckboxes";
import { Inside, Middle} from "./foto.styles";
const Home = () => {
const {checked} = Checker()
return <>
<Wrapper>
<Inside>
<Middle>
{checked && <House src={house}/>}
</Middle>
</Inside>
</Wrapper>
</>
}
export default Home;
Some issues are:
Checker looks like you want it to be a custom hook, not a React component, so it should be called useChecker or something like that, not Checker
You have both a change handler and a click handler. You should only have one. If you want the new state to come from the checkbox, you should use e.target.checked. If you want the new state to flip the old state, use the clickHandler you defined in Checker.
You only need a fragment when enclosing multiple elements. If you only have one, you don't need a fragment.
Because state setters don't update the variable immediately, your console.log(checked) won't display the new value, but the old value - if you want to log the new value when it changes, use useEffect with a dependency array of [checked] instead.
const Extra = () => {
const { checked, clickHandler } = useChecker()
return (
<Extras>
<Wrapper>
<input type='checkbox'checked={checked} onChange={clickHandler} />
</Wrapper>
</Extras>
)
}
use it like that
const {checked, clickHandler, setChecked} = Checker()
Or if you want to be able to make custom names then you need to use an array instead of an object.
the function return value.
return [checked, clickHandler, setChecked]
the function call
const [checked, setChecked, clickHandler] = Checker()
and for convention follow react hooks naming rules by renaming the function to useChecker() instead of Checker()
